Margin-left是CSS中最基本的样式之一,它可以用于控制文本和图像之间的距离,可以提高网页的可读性和美观度。在这篇文章中,我们将讨论如何通过使用margin-left属性来提高网页排版的美观性。
1、了解margin-left属性
Margin-left属性定义了元素的左侧空白区域的宽度。它可以接受各种单位(如像素、em、百分比等),并且可以是正值、负值或0。例如,如果我们将margin-left属性设置为20px,则元素的左侧空白区域将会有20个像素的宽度。
2、使用margin-left属性调整文本对齐方式
在排版网页时,我们经常需要将文本对齐到左侧或右侧。通过设置margin-left属性,我们可以非常容易地调整文本对齐方式。如果我们希望文本向右对齐并保持左侧留白,则可以将margin-left属性设置为负值。例如,如果我们将margin-left属性设置为-20px,则文本将会向右对齐,并且在左侧留白20px的宽度。
3、应用margin-left属性来设置图像的对齐方式
同样,我们可以使用margin-left属性来对齐网页上的图像。如果我们想要图像靠左对齐并留出一些空白,可以通过将margin-left属性设置为正值来实现。例如,如果我们将margin-left属性设置为10px,则图像将会向右移动并保持左侧留白10px的宽度。
4、使用margin-left属性为列表添加缩进
在HTML中,使用无序列表和有序列表是指定内容的有效方式。使用margin-left属性可以调整列表项目之间的距离,并通过为每个编号和项目添加左边距来制作增强的缩进列表。例如,可以将margin-left属性设置为30px,并将其应用于有序列表和/或无序列表样式。
5、应用margin-left属性来制作网页的多列布局
如果文本和图像的数量较多,我们可能需要将网页分成多列来提高可读性。使用margin-left属性,在CSS中,我们可以将不同列之间的宽度设置为不同的值,创建各种布局类型。例如,如果我们希望网页有两列,则可以将margin-left属性设置为50%的宽度。
6、使用margin-left属性减少网页中不必要的空间
在设计网页时,我们希望查找和减少不必要的元素和空间。通过使用margin-left属性,我们可以在必要时减少网页中不必要的空间。例如,如果我们使用margin-left属性从左侧增加了空间和间距,则我们可能不需要再在模块和元素中使用padding或其他样式。
综上所述,margin-left属性对于提高网页的排版是至关重要的。它可以用于调整文本对齐方式,图像位置和列表缩进。通过使用margin-left属性,我们可以轻松地制作多列布局和减少不必要的空间。因此,在创建网页时,我们建议使用margin-left属性以提高排版的美观性和可读性。